Auditing

At Joseph MAthew & Co Ltd, we understand the importance of accurate and reliable financial reporting. That's why we offer a wide range of auditing services to help ensure that our clients' financial statements are in compliance with applicable laws and regulations, and are free from material misstatements.

Our auditing services include:

Audit under Indian Income Tax Act 1961: We provide tax audit services under the Indian Income Tax Act, 1961, to help our clients comply with the tax laws and regulations. Our team of experienced auditors will thoroughly review your financial records, transactions, and other relevant information to ensure that your tax returns are accurate and complete.

Audit under The Companies Act 2013: Our audit services under The Companies Act, 2013, include statutory audits, internal audits, and other related services. We help our clients meet the regulatory requirements of the Companies Act and provide valuable insights into their financial performance and risk management.

Audit under GST Act 2017: We offer GST audit services to help businesses comply with the Goods and Services Tax (GST) Act, 2017. Our team of experts will conduct a comprehensive review of your GST records, transactions, and other relevant information to ensure that your GST returns are accurate and complete.

Bank Audit:

Our bank audit services help financial institutions comply with the regulatory requirements and internal policies of the Reserve Bank of India (RBI). We provide a thorough review of the bank's financial records, transactions, and other relevant information to ensure that the bank is operating in accordance with the applicable laws and regulations.

Internal Audit: Our internal audit services help businesses identify and mitigate risks, improve operational efficiency, and enhance overall performance. We provide a comprehensive review of the internal controls and processes of the organization and provide recommendations for improvement.
